| Methods of Education III -Research about mathematics education and Lesson Study: A cross-cultural perspective- 概要/Outline
|
| The course will present and discuss aspects of research about mathematics education and lesson study in Switzerland. Basic concepts of French mathematics education will be introduced, compared and contrasted with the lesson study features. These concepts will be applied to a research about teachers’ use of Mathematical Knowledge for Teaching during a lesson study. Softwares used during this research (for transcription, qualitative analysis, presentation, referencing, translating) will be presented by the instructor and tried by the participants on their own laptop. If possible, students in groups will analyse some data using some concepts and tools presented.
| 到達目標/Objectives
|
| 1: Get a basic understanding of concepts originated in French mathematics education and contrast them with Japanese Problem-Solving Learning. 2: Get to know the results of a research using the Japanese originated lesson study and international theoretical frameworks. 3: Explore the opportunities of softwares used in various stages of qualitative research in education.
